How AI Hair Style Recommendation Systems Work

AI hair analysis uses advanced computer vision technology to analyze client images. This process involves several layers of analysis to understand what hairstyles would suit a person best. There are three main factors that these systems look at:

1. Face Shape Recognition

The technology measures various parts of the face such as the distance between cheekbones, width of the jawline, and size of the forehead. Based on these measurements, it can determine whether a person’s face is oval, square, round, heart-shaped, diamond, or rectangular. The algorithms used in this process can map up to 68 specific points on the face to get an accurate shape analysis.

2. Skin Undertone Detection

Advanced techniques are employed to analyze the colors beneath the skin’s surface. By studying how light interacts with the skin, the system can identify whether someone has warm, cool, or neutral undertones. This information is crucial for recommending hair colors that will complement a person’s natural complexion.

3. Hair Texture Assessment

The AI also examines the characteristics of an individual’s hair through image analysis. It looks at factors like thickness of each strand, curl pattern (if any), and overall density of the hair. This assessment helps in understanding how different hairstyles will work with different hair types.

Machine learning algorithms continuously improve these assessments by studying thousands of successful styling outcomes. With each consultation processed through the system, prediction accuracy gets better and better.

Technological Features Enhancing Salon Consultations

Modern AI systems bring sophisticated capabilities that transform the consultation experience through advanced visual and analytical tools.

1. Real-time Virtual Try-On Technology

Real-time virtual try-on technology, a subset of augmented reality in the beauty industry, allows clients to see themselves with different hairstyles instantaneously. This creates an interactive experience that builds confidence in their styling decisions. The software captures facial features with precision, overlaying various cuts, lengths, and styles while maintaining realistic proportions and movement.

2. Color Simulation Under Lighting Conditions

Color simulation under lighting conditions represents a significant breakthrough in managing client expectations. AI algorithms can demonstrate how a chosen shade will appear in natural daylight, fluorescent office lighting, evening ambiance, and outdoor settings. This feature prevents the common disappointment when salon lighting differs from real-world environments, helping clients understand how their new color will look throughout their daily routines. 3. Hair Growth Pattern Analysis

The technology excels at hair growth pattern analysis, examining natural cowlicks, whorl patterns, and hair density distribution across the scalp. AI systems identify these characteristics through image analysis and recommend cuts that work with, rather than against, natural growth directions. This analysis proves particularly valuable for clients with challenging hair patterns, as stylists receive data-driven insights about which styles will maintain their shape between appointments and which require excessive styling effort. The system can also predict how specific cuts will behave as hair grows out, helping clients choose low-maintenance options that suit their lifestyle.

Challenges and Considerations When Adopting AI Hair Tools

The journey to implementing AI hair style recommendation systems comes with several challenges that salons must carefully navigate.

Financial Commitments

One of the main challenges is the significant financial investment required. Salons need to spend money on:

Hardware

Software licenses

Ongoing maintenance costs

These expenses can put a strain on budgets, especially for independent salons or smaller chains. Salon owners must carefully consider if the long-term benefits of AI tools are worth these upfront costs.

Training Stylists

Another major challenge is training stylists. Stylists who are used to traditional consultation methods will need thorough training to effectively use AI systems. This learning process may temporarily reduce productivity as staff members adjust to new workflows and learn how to interpret AI-generated recommendations alongside their professional expertise.

Data Privacy Concerns

As clients become more aware of how their personal information and images are stored and used, concerns about data privacy in the beauty industry have become increasingly important. Salons must establish clear policies regarding:

  • How facial recognition data is collected and processed
  • Storage duration and security measures for client photographs
  • Third-party access to biometric information
  • Client rights to request data deletion

Some clients may feel uncomfortable with having their facial features analyzed and stored digitally. Salons need to have clear consent procedures in place and be able to offer alternative consultation methods for individuals who prioritize privacy. Compliance with regulations such as GDPR or CCPA adds another layer of complexity to the implementation process, requiring legal review and potentially additional administrative resources.
